We’ve all seen countless t-shirts with nationalistic slogans or destination names. But “Kenya Ni Home” hits differently. It’s not just about geography; it’s about a feeling. “Ni Home” translates to “is home,” and it speaks volumes about the deep connection Kenyans, and those who have embraced Kenya, feel for this vibrant nation.

Why “Kenya Ni Home” Resonates So Deeply:

A Sense of Belonging: For Kenyans, whether living within its borders or in the diaspora, this phrase immediately evokes a powerful sense of belonging. It’s a reminder of roots, family, culture, and the inimitable spirit of Kenya.

Warmth and Welcome: For non-Kenyans who have lived, worked, or simply fallen in love with the country, “Kenya Ni Home” signifies the warmth and welcoming nature of its people and the embrace of its diverse landscapes.

More Than Just a Place: Home isn’t just a physical location; it’s a feeling of comfort, safety, and identity. This t-shirt beautifully captures that sentiment.

A Symbol of Unity: In a world often grappling with divisions, a simple statement like “Kenya Ni Home” can serve as a unifying symbol, reminding everyone of shared heritage and collective pride.

The Power of Simplicity: The design, featuring the words in the iconic colors of the Kenyan flag – red and green – against a classic black background, is elegant in its simplicity. It’s a design that lets the message speak for itself.
